    Should I increase weight if I'm 1-2 reps off target?

    Hi,

    I was wondering when I should increase the weight on some of my exercises. To give a specific example, let's say I was doing military presses at 45x10 for 4 sets. I increased the weight to 50, and my sets looked like this:

    50x10, 50x10, 50x9, 50x9

    It's now time for another day of shoulder stuff. I know I can do 50x10 for 4 sets now probably without much trouble. Should I increase the load to 55 and maybe do 55x8 or 55x9, or should I wait until I can cleanly hit my target 10 reps with 50 lbs?

    I would personally save the PRs for the last set. Thats what I usually do. You REALLY don't want to try for a PR the first workout only to find that you failed on the 5th rep and now your shoulders are burnt to **** and you cant even manage the same reps/weight as last workout for the rest of your sets. For me, I don't mind taking it slow so I usually do a PR on the last set, then the next workout I still use the old weight for the first set or two, then the next week I try for all sets on the new PR weight. Usually by this time I feel good enough to try for another PR on the last set. Sometimes I feel good enough to set a new PR the next workout and I end up using 3 different weights for my sets!
